Repossession of joint mortgaged property & bankrupty

I'm currently bankrupt and tied in to a mortgage with an ex bf who's doing everything he can to make my life more difficult. The mortgage hasn't been paid for around 9/10 months and the house has been abandoned for a long time. My ex has changed the locks so I can't receive any post from the mortgage company, but I phone them every now and again to see what's going on. I called a couple of weeks ago and they weren't even close to repossessing it apparently. I'm currently bankrupt and I just want to get rid of the house ASAP so I can put the whole thing behind me. I'm not even sure how the process works. I'd be willing to just sign my half over, but I know he wont because he knows the shortfall will go to him, and he wants to make things more complicated for me. Maybe he's just trying to delay it for as long as possible, hoping the market changes so it will be worth more, then it will sell for more at auction and maybe he wont end up owing anything.

Just wondering if there's anything I can do? I assume I can't speed the process up. Will I have to go to court or anything? Any info on how it all works would be appreciated :)
